So I looked on the inmate search so far he's got a kidnapping charge 4 counts of murder bc he confessed to the Gaffney Superbike murders where he shot 4 people ,a case that went 13 years unsolved mind you plus he killed the bf so there's 5 counts of murder plus they found 2 more bodies on his land so possibly 7 counts of murder...so yeah dudes probably getting the death penalty

quote:

Not having a conscience is a mental illness doofus


No, a mental illness can be treated. Not having a conscience is a birth defect, Sasquatch.

quote:

It's Conduct Disorder until 18 then it gets switched to Anti Social Disorder


Conduct Disorder and Anti-social Disorder are catch-all terms. They are not diagnoses.

quote:

There is no such thing as psychopaths it has been written out of the DSM


quote:

The DSM and International Classification of Diseases (ICD) subsequently introduced the diagnoses of antisocial personality disorder (ASPD) and dissocial personality disorder respectively, stating that these diagnoses have been referred to (or include what is referred to) as psychopathy or sociopathy.


This was done to eliminate confusion associated with diagnosing psychopathy, sociopathy, narcissism, psychosis, neurosis, etc.

However, a rose by any other name...
